    Professional Background

    Dr. David Saah is a prominent environmental scientist renowned for his expertise across a spectrum of environmental fields including landscape ecology, ecosystem ecology, hydrology, geomorphology, ecosystem modeling, natural hazard modeling, and remote sensing. Currently, he serves as a Professor and the Director of the Geospatial Analysis Lab at the University of San Francisco (USF), where he imparts knowledge while actively engaged in cutting-edge research. Dr. Saah's career has been marked by substantial contributions that span both national and international research projects, thus broadening his impact in the field of environmental science.

    Dr. Saah utilizes integrated geospatial science techniques for multi-scale mapping, monitoring, and modeling of environmental spatial heterogeneity. His work focuses particularly on riparian, savanna, and forest ecosystems, where he pursues the quantification of landscape pattern changes and investigates the dynamic relationships between these patterns and ecological processes. This holistic approach enhances the understanding of how various environmental management regimes influence ecosystem functionality, making Dr. Saah a critical figure in natural resource management and environmental assessment.

    Leveraging his extensive background, Dr. Saah also engages in consulting, where he develops decision support systems for effective resource management. His consulting engagements often involve assessing natural hazards and evaluating ecosystem services, showcasing his prowess in translating complex environmental data into practical applications.
